Why is 5-Nitro-2-furaldehyde Diacetate Essential?
5-Nitro-2-furaldehyde diacetate serves as a vital precursor in the chemical synthesis pathway for several important drugs. Most notably, it is used to produce furazolidone, a nitrofuran antibiotic effective against various bacterial and protozoal infections, including those affecting the gastrointestinal tract. It is also a key component in the manufacturing of other furan-based drugs such as butyl nitrofurazone and nitrofurantoin. The compound's structure, featuring a nitro group on a furan ring with acetate functionalities, makes it an ideal starting material for creating molecules with potent antimicrobial activity. Specifications and Sourcing for Pharmaceutical Use
When procuring 5-Nitro-2-furaldehyde diacetate, pharmaceutical companies look for specific quality benchmarks. Typically, the required purity is ≥98.0%, often classified as Pharma Grade. Physical characteristics, such as an exceedingly light yellow crystal powder appearance, are also noted. Suppliers usually offer it in packaging suitable for industrial use, such as 25kg fiber drums.
